The closure of Qatar's largest liquefied natural gas (LNG) facility has led to a helium supply crisis, threatening many vital sectors such as healthcare and technology. This crisis comes at a sensitive time, as many medical and technological applications rely on helium, an essential element in numerous processes.
Helium is a critical element in various applications, including magnetic resonance imaging (MRI), semiconductor manufacturing, and defense technology. Clive Kane, the CEO of Pulsar Helium, noted that the negative impacts of this closure could be far-reaching, especially given the ongoing conflicts in the Middle East.
Details of the Event
Qatar, one of the largest producers of LNG in the world, announced the closure of its major facility, which directly affected helium supplies. Helium, typically extracted as a byproduct during natural gas extraction, is now in a critical position due to this closure. This situation has led to rising prices and supply shortages in global markets, threatening the stability of many industries.
This crisis is a direct result of the ongoing conflicts in the Middle East, which significantly impact supply chains. Kane pointed out that this crisis could lead to delays in the production of medical and technological devices, adversely affecting healthcare and defense technology.

Helium is a rare material, heavily relied upon in medical and technological applications. With increasing demand for this material, any supply shortage can lead to negative effects on many sectors. Global markets have already witnessed price hikes due to this shortage.
Impact & Consequences
The helium crisis could have negative effects on public health, as many hospitals depend on helium for MRI procedures. Additionally, helium shortages may impact the semiconductor industry, which is essential for manufacturing modern electronic devices.
Moreover, the economic impacts could be significant, as rising prices may reduce investments in technological sectors. Companies may find themselves forced to delay projects or cut production, affecting overall economic growth.
